directions

  • preheat oven to gas mark 6
  • in a mixer beat togther the eggs and sugar until they become mousey and leave ribbon trails in the mixer, this takes my kenwood about 5 minutes, add 1 vanilla essence and beat for 30 seconds extra.
  • crush cofee granules into fine powder and mix evenly with flour.
  • gently fold in the flour using your fingers to scissor through the mixture ensuring it is just mixed without huge lumps.
  • Divide between two greased and floured sandwich tins and bake in middle shelf for 12- 14 minutes until springy on top and light golden.
  • allow to coool in tin for 5 minutes before turning out onto rack to cool.
  • once cool spread with choclate spread, whipped cream or dream topping sandwhich and dust with icing sugar, cocoa powder and cinamon.
